Looking to advance your career in data analytics or data science? Choosing the right online master’s program is key to unlocking high-demand roles in a rapidly growing field. At OU Online, you can choose from four specialized master’s degrees–Econometrics, Applied Statistics, Business Analytics, and Data Science & Analytics–each designed to help you turn data insights into career impact.
Each flexible online degree is structured to support distinct career paths, academic goals, and skill sets. In a world where organizations are increasingly relying on data-driven decision-making, selecting the right program is a crucial step for applicants seeking a competitive advantage.
The data backs up the urgency. Employment of data scientists is projected to grow 36% from 2023 to 2033, according to the U.S. Bureau of Labor Statistics, far outpacing most industries. At the same time, more than 90% of organizations report measurable value from their analytics investments, according to a Coherent Solutions article.
In this fast-evolving landscape, the specialization you choose matters–whether econometrics, applied statistics, business analytics, or data science–can shape your direction in research, business strategy, or technology innovation.
Master of Arts in Econometrics: This degree is designed for students captivated by economics and policy research.
Master of Science in Applied Statistics: Perfect for students seeking versatility. Choose this degree for its breadth in statistical applications, from healthcare and politics to industry and research.
Master of Science in Business Analytics: For those interested in applying analytics directly to business challenges, this program teaches how to harness data for strategic decisions.
Master of Science in Data Science & Analytics: This degree is for aspiring data scientists and engineers.
| Degree | MA in Econometrics | MS in Applied Statistics | MS in Business Analytics | MS in Data Science & Analytics | Primary Focus | Economic/statistical modeling | Broad statistical methods | Business intelligence, analytics | Coding, modeling, big data |
|---|---|---|---|---|
| Skills Emphasized | Modeling, quantitative analysis | Statistics, research, software | Management Info Systems, Analytics Programming, Data Warehousing | Programming, Machine Learning, visualization |
| Typical Courses | Mathematical Economics, Econometrics, Data Science | Applied Statistics, Bayesian Statistics, R, SAS, SQL | Management Info Systems, Analytics Programming, Data Warehousing | Machine Learning, Big Data, Data Mining |
| Best Fit For... | Economics interests, policy, research | Diverse statistical applications | Applied business problem solvers | Tech-driven, hands-on, coding enthusiasts |
| Career Paths | Research/Financial Analyst, Economist | Statistician, Data Scientist, Analyst, Biostatistician | Business/Market Intelligence Analyst, Consultant | Data Scientist, ML Engineer, Software Engineer |
| Industries | Finance, Government, Academia | Healthcare, Insurance, Industry, Research | Business, Supply Chain, Finance, Marketing | IT, Tech Companies, Healthcare, Government |
Each program is 100% online, but the program structure (live session frequency and synchronous/asynchronous mix) differs slightly across the programs. Completion time ranges from 16 to 24 months. Tuition for 2025-26 ranges from around $25,350 for Econometrics and Applied Statistics to over $33,000 for Data Science Analytics.
| Program Name | Credit Hours | Duration (Months) | Tuition (2025-26) | MA in Econometrics | 30 | 18 | $25,350 |
|---|---|---|---|
| MS in Applied Statistics | 30 | 21 | $25,350 |
| MS in Business Analytics | 32 | 16 | $32,480 |
| MS in Data Science Analytics | 33 | 24 | $33,495 |
Econometrics: The MA in Econometrics is designed for students who want deep immersion in economic theory, modeling, and policy analysis. This program prepares you for serious quantitative research or policy work, typically favored by those with a love for economics and mathematics. Graduates are prepared for careers as economists, economic consultants, financial analysts, risk analysts, auditors, and more.
Applied Statistics: An MS in Applied Statistics will be the best fit if your interests span applying statistics to healthcare, industry, sports, or research. It is broad, with both theory and practical applications, and provides strong computing skills—suitable if you wish to be a statistician or data analyst across fields. Graduates can enter a broad range of careers, including statistician, data analyst, data scientist, market research analyst, data engineer, healthcare analytics, and more.
Business Analytics: The MS in Business Analytics is tailored for the data-driven business problem solver. This option is for those who want real-world, business-oriented projects that use analytics to inform strategy and improve efficiency. The curriculum is rich in business intelligence and prepares graduates to make impactful data-based decisions in the workplace. You’ll be ready for careers as varied as business systems analyst, business intelligence analyst, business consultant, analytics manager, market research analyst, computer systems analyst, and more.
Data Science & Analytics: The MS in Data Science & Analytics is ideal if you aspire to be a data scientist or machine learning engineer, aiming for roles that demand both coding and statistical skills for work with big data, AI, and predictive modeling. This program offers the most technical preparation in programming, database systems, and advanced analytics for fast-evolving tech-driven industries. You’ll be prepared for careers as a data scientist, data architect, data engineer, data modeler, database administrator, big data analyst, artificial intelligence engineer, machine learning engineer, and more.
